Homes for sale with energy-efficient options typically have superior insulation, superior HVAC systems, and energy-efficient home windows. These aspects assist regulate temperature and reduce the reliance on heating and cooling, resulting in lower month-to-month energy bills.
Solar panels are becoming one of the most sought-after options in modern energy-efficient homes. By harnessing sunlight, these panels can drastically cut back or even eliminate electrical energy costs. Many potential buyers are desperate to put cash into homes outfitted with solar energy, viewing them as a long-term investment that pays off over time.
Smart home technology can also be a important factor in energy efficiency. Innovations corresponding to programmable thermostats, smart lighting, and energy administration methods allow homeowners to watch and management their energy use more successfully. Buyers are more and more looking for homes that may seamlessly combine these technologies, which not only helps in saving energy but also enhances their way of life.

- Homes equipped with solar panels can considerably scale back electricity bills whereas contributing to a sustainable energy grid.
- Energy-efficient home equipment, such as refrigerators and washing machines, not solely eat much less energy but additionally ensure lower monthly utility expenses.
- Advanced insulation materials in walls and roofs enhance temperature regulation, keeping homes warm in winter and cool in summer season.
- Programmable thermostats allow homeowners to optimize heating and cooling schedules, maximizing consolation and efficiency.
- Double or triple-glazed windows reduce warmth loss and enhance indoor air high quality by minimizing drafts and outdoor noise.
- Smart home technology integrates energy monitoring methods, enabling homeowners to trace usage and optimize energy consumption effectively.
- Landscaping choices like xeriscaping can minimize water usage, promoting a more environmentally friendly and low-maintenance yard.
- Energy-efficient outside lighting options, such as LED fixtures, deliver improved illumination for security and aesthetics while conserving energy.
- On-demand water heaters present sizzling water solely when wanted, reducing energy waste associated with traditional tank methods.

What financing options exist for buying energy-efficient homes?
Homebuyers can discover various financing choices for energy-efficient homes, including green mortgages, Energy Efficient Mortgage (EEM) programs, and government incentives. These choices often enable for higher mortgage quantities to cowl energy-efficient upgrades, making it easier to spend money on such homes.

Can I retrofit my current home to be extra energy-efficient?
Yes, many energy-efficient upgrades can be made to current homes, similar to adding insulation, changing windows, upgrading to energy-efficient home equipment, and putting in smart home technology. Retrofitting can result in vital energy savings and elevated comfort.
